Aces Walk Off Over Rainiers, 4-3

July 10, 2015 - Pacific Coast League (PCL1)
Tacoma Rainiers News Release


RENO, Nev. - A walk-off infield single in the ninth inning gave the Reno Aces a 4-3 victory over the Tacoma Rainiers on Friday night at Aces Ballpark.

Outfielder James Jones (2x4) recorded the Rainiers only multi-hit performance, while adding a pair of runs scored and swiping one stolen base - Jones now has 21 stolen bases this year, tied for the third best mark in the league.

Infielder Zach Shank blasted his first career Triple-A home run in the top of the seventh inning to pull the Rainiers even with Reno at 3-3. Through his first 20 Triple-A games, Shank has hit .304 (21x69) with six extra base hits and six RBI.

Tacoma starting pitcher Andrew Kittredge, making just the fourth start of his career, worked 5.0 innings and allowed three runs on five hits.

Stefen Romero and Steve Baron added stolen bases of their own to give the Rainiers three in the contest. Tacoma's 108 stolen bases are the top mark in the league.

Tyler Olson relieved Kittredge and posted 2.0 scoreless innings, holding the Aces to just one hit and striking out four. Edgar Olmos posted a scoreless eighth inning, but allowed a one-out double to come around and score for the winning run in the ninth - he was tagged with his first loss of the year.

Right-hander Forrest Snow (7-5, 2.55) takes the mound for Tacoma (44-45) as they continue their series with Reno (42-47) tomorrow, July 11. The Aces will hand the ball to righty Edgar Garcia (2-1, 4.09). First pitch is scheduled for 7:05 p.m.
